From 3c23700e56527a106a4f1ce6c1e40534d52702ba Mon Sep 17 00:00:00 2001 From: Zoltan Papp Date: Tue, 16 Jun 2026 15:54:46 +0200 Subject: [PATCH] [client] Add iOS debug bundle support in Go (#6270) * Add iOS debug bundle support in Go Thread cacheDir through NewClient -> RunOniOS -> MobileDependency.TempDir so the iOS client can pass its sandbox-writable cache directory for debug bundle zip file creation instead of os.TempDir(). Move log collection into platform-dispatched addPlatformLog(): - iOS: adds the file-based Go client log (with rotation, stderr/stdout companions and anonymization handled by addLogfile) plus the Swift app log (swift-log.log) written by the iOS app into the same log directory - Other non-Android platforms: existing file-based log + systemd fallback Narrow the debug_nonandroid.go build tag to !android && !ios so iOS no longer attempts the systemd journal fallback. Add a DebugBundle() entry point to the iOS Go client that generates a bundle, uploads it and returns the upload key. It works with or without a running engine: when the engine is up it reuses the live config, sync response and client metrics; otherwise it loads the config from disk (or the preloaded tvOS config). Guard the live config/ConnectClient behind a state mutex since DebugBundle may run on a different thread. * Include the iOS state file in the debug bundle addStateFile() resolved the state path via ServiceManager.GetStatePath(), which on iOS points at a hard-coded default that does not exist in the app sandbox, so the state file was silently skipped. Add an optional StatePath to GeneratorDependencies and use it when set, falling back to the ServiceManager default otherwise. The iOS DebugBundle passes the client's actual state file path (the App Group profile state), matching the Android bundle which includes the state file. * ios: enable sync response persistence for debug bundle Turn on sync response persistence before starting the engine so DebugBundle can include the network map. On iOS the store is disk-backed (see syncstore) to keep the map out of the constrained process memory. * ios: pass log file path through NewClient constructor (#6393) Add logFilePath field to Client struct and expose it as a parameter in NewClient so callers provide the Go log path at construction time. Wire it into DebugBundle via GeneratorDependencies.LogPath so the debug bundle includes client.log and swift-log.log regardless of whether the bundle is triggered by the app or the management server. Co-authored-by: Claude Sonnet 4.6 * ios: pass log file path to engine for remote debug bundles RunOniOS started the engine with an empty LogPath, so EngineConfig.LogPath was never set. Management-triggered (jobs) debug bundles read the log path from the engine config, so they collected no client logs (client.log, rotated logs, swift-log.log). The GUI path was unaffected because it passes c.logFilePath directly to the bundle generator.
